Experts explain why two ETF industry giants are sitting out Bitcoin-ETF race
Despite all the hype surrounding spot a Bitcoin (BTC) exchange traded fund (ETF), two of the biggest issuers in the industry are brushing off the buildup. As journalists from Bloomberg note, two of the industry ’s three largest ETF companies are deliberately sitting out on the bid to introduce BTC to the market. The two entities — Vanguard and State Street — are poised to miss out on the frothing speculation posed by the asset’s institutional introduction. Officials from Vanguard said that the company does not intend to offer a spot Bitcoin ETF or any other cryptocurrency-related products. Vanguard believes that the investment attractiveness of cryptocurrencies could be more substantial.
